Ship Moves To Make Way For Hotel

Newcastle Herald

Saturday September 16, 2000

REPLICA paddle-steamer William the Fourth will leave Newcastle's Merewether St wharf for the last time in a while to-morrow.

The ship will move temporarily in front of the A shed before it goes to a new berth at Lee Wharf.

It will continue its popular public cruises from both locations.

The move is required to allow preparatory work for the proposed Honeysuckle hotel development at the Merewether St wharf.

Tomorrow will be the last day members of the public can take a 1-hour Newcastle Harbour cruise from the Merewether St wharf.
